Since offset is zeor, it's not necessary to use set function. Reset
function is straightforward, and will remove the unnecessary add
operation in set function.

Signed-off-by: Zhang Shengju <zhangshen...@cmss.chinamobile.com>
---
 drivers/net/wireless/mac80211_hwsim.c | 4 ++--
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/net/wireless/mac80211_hwsim.c 
b/drivers/net/wireless/mac80211_hwsim.c
index a28414c..7b570bf 100644
--- a/drivers/net/wireless/mac80211_hwsim.c
+++ b/drivers/net/wireless/mac80211_hwsim.c
@@ -844,7 +844,7 @@ static void mac80211_hwsim_monitor_rx(struct ieee80211_hw 
*hw,
        hdr->rt_chbitmask = cpu_to_le16(flags);
 
        skb->dev = hwsim_mon;
-       skb_set_mac_header(skb, 0);
+       skb_reset_mac_header(skb);
        skb->ip_summed = CHECKSUM_UNNECESSARY;
        skb->pkt_type = PACKET_OTHERHOST;
        skb->protocol = htons(ETH_P_802_2);
@@ -887,7 +887,7 @@ static void mac80211_hwsim_monitor_ack(struct 
ieee80211_channel *chan,
        memcpy(hdr11->addr1, addr, ETH_ALEN);
 
        skb->dev = hwsim_mon;
-       skb_set_mac_header(skb, 0);
+       skb_reset_mac_header(skb);
        skb->ip_summed = CHECKSUM_UNNECESSARY;
        skb->pkt_type = PACKET_OTHERHOST;
        skb->protocol = htons(ETH_P_802_2);
